Fernis is looking for an aspiring junior UX/UI designer to join our team in central Copenhagen. Fernis is a start-up that wants to change the handling of artworks and information in the art industry. Our product is for galleries, artists, collectors and other stakeholders. We are a passionate team working towards transforming the way the industry works and shares information with each other.
As a designer, you will be involved throughout the entire product development lifecycle, from brainstorming the initial concepts to creating the final UI designs and delivering assets. This includes understanding user journeys and technical limitations, as well as creating wireframes and interactive prototypes to test your solutions.
